Standard Water Softener Fitting Price & Rate Analysis

So, you're considering getting a liquid softener installed? Great choice! But how will it cost? Typically, the typical setup cost hovers between $200 and $1200, however this may differ quite a bit. A significant portion of the cost covers the equipment itself – expect to shell out $300 to $1500 subject to size and capabilities. Labor typically adds $200 to $800, and always forget about permits, which could cost another $50. Finally, plumbing modifications, if required, can increase the final cost.

DIY vs. Expert Water Conditioner Placement: A Cost Analysis

Deciding whether to tackle a water softener setup yourself or hire a professional is a significant financial consideration. While self-installation might initially appear more appealing due to skipping service fees, the potential drawbacks can quickly escalate. A homeowner installation could price anywhere from $200 to $800, primarily covering the system unit itself and some basic plumbing supplies. However, mistakes, like incorrect fixture connections or improper electrical work, can lead to costly repairs, potentially exceeding the cost of a certified installation. Conversely, professional placement generally ranges from $500 to $2,500, including labor, warranty, and skill. Ultimately, the best selection hinges on your experience expertise with plumbing and power work, and a careful consideration of the potential prices involved.
